CONGRATULATING THE FIRM OF LEO A. DALY
Mr. HAGEL. Mr. President, today I congratulate the international
architecture and engineering firm Leo A. Daly for its direction,
construction and design of the National World War II Memorial. The
completion of the National World War II Memorial, which was dedicated
last weekend, would not have been possible without the Leo A. Daly
firm. I am particularly proud of this firm since it was founded 89
years ago in my home State of Nebraska.
The National World War II Memorial acknowledges the service and
sacrifice of those who served our country during World War II.
According to The Commission of Fine Arts, the memorial is ``an eloquent
statement worthy of the subject and the site.''
I congratulate and thank the Leo A. Daly employees who have honored
the service of our Nation's ``greatest generation'' through the
construction of this National World War II Memorial.
